Islamabad: Pakistan has received 1.24 million more doses of AstraZeneca vaccine under the Covax programme.

According to details, a consignment containing 1.24 million AstraZeneca jabs reached Islamabad this morning.
On May 08, Pakistan had received the first batch of the British vaccine and since then the country has received three consignments of Covid vaccines under the Covax programme.
Earlier, 1.62m doses of Pfizer vaccine and 2.5m doses of Moderna were received by Pakistan.
Pakistan has reported a sharp increase in Covid-19 cases and deaths amid concerns of fourth wave of coronavirus owing to Delta variant.
According to National Command and Operations Center (NCOC), around 2,783 cases of coronavirus were reported while 39 people succumbed to the disease in the last 24 hours, taking the total death toll to 22,760.
The total number of confirmed cases reached to 986,668.
As many as 918,329 patients have recovered from the disease with 2,508 critical cases.
